  • BG1NPC

    The BG1 NPC Project adds a great deal of content by expanding the depth of character and levels of interaction with the NPCs from the Baldur's Gate game. Requires Tutu, BGT, or BGEE.

  • BGEE-Classic-Movies

    This is a WeiDU mod that restores the 'classic' movies from the original Baldur's Gate and select movies from Baldur's Gate II to BGEE/SoD/EET. There is a new component that restores the vanilla BG1 chapter and dream screens to BGEE/SoD/EET (using the appropriate theme).
